WELSHPOOL maintained their solid start top the North Wales League Two season with a thrilling 29-25 victory at Abergele.
Tries from Nick Morris, Max Cadwallader, Kieron Evans, Ryan Goodwin and Drew Evans with a brace of conversions from Dylan Walton edged the spoils for Pool.
Abergele replied with two tries and penalties from Owain Davies along with one try from Chris Marsh and a brace of conversions from Mark Benton.
Meanwhile a makeshift Llanidloes continued their early season struggles with Andrew Griffiths’ try scant consolation in a 57-5 defeat at Colwyn Bay.
Elsewhere Newtown’s clash at Wrexham was postponed along with the third division clash between Machynlleth and Pwllheli IIs.
